Bio:Attorney, James G. Quinn, joined the Law Offices of John W. Conrad III, LLC as an associate in January 2011. He focuses his practice on civil litigation while taking a particular interest in family law. Mr. Quinn, in addition to a strong trial practice, represents clients in all areas of family law, including, but not limited to, divorce, child custody & visitation, child support, alimony, property disposition, separation agreements, property settlement agreements, pre-nuptial agreements, postnuptial agreements, protective orders, temporary restraining orders & injunctions, enforcement proceedings, modification proceedings, contempt proceedings, adoptions, and name changes. In addition to having worked as a paralegal and associate for several years. Mr. Quinn has also worked as a law clerk to Special Master, Barry Silber (Howard Country), and for the Maryland Department of Juvenile Justice, appearing in Circuit Courts throughout Maryland. Mr. Quinn is a member of the American Bar Association, Maryland State Bar Association, and the Baltimore County Bar Association. Mr. Quinn earned his B.S. from Penn State University in Rehabilitation Services (Counseling)(2001), a degree that has proved useful while dealing with the extremely emotional area of family law practice. He earned a Paralegal Certificate from Anne Arundel Community College (General Practice)(2003), and his J.D. from Widener University School of Law (2009). Quinn is one of the more than one million lawyers in United States. Before choosing James G. Quinn as your lawyer, you should consider whether James G. Quinn offers free consultation, (if not) how much the initial interview costs, if there is any hidden attorney fees, what's the fee schedule, whether he or she has good community reputation and is able to provide a list of good references. You can also contact the Board of Professional Responsibility of the state bar, to find out if James G. Quinn has ever been placed under any disciplinary actions. Please be aware that, though James G. Quinn's office is located at Baltimore, MD, he or she might belong to the bar association of other states.

You should also ask how long the lawyer has been in practice, how much experience he or she has in cases like yours, and more importantly, the outcomes of those cases! Focus of the lawyer's practice and years of experience are also very important factors in your evaluation process. The more focused the lawyer's practice areas, the better service he or she could provide. So do not make decisions solely on one or two factors. Only hire lawyers you feel comfortable with as they will represent you and your interests, and you will be sharing private details about your life with them.
